A gang sold fake prescription drugs worth more £20million on the dark web to fund their lavish lifestyles which they bragged about on social media. The crooks, including one man from Kent, sold drugs such as Xanax and other benzodiazepines from their lab in Gravesend and blew the money on expensive champagne. Dartford man Thomas Durden, 36, Christopher Kirkby, 35, Marc Ward, 36, flashed their trips to fancy restaurants and nightclubs in posts on their Instagram pages.
